This episode of Oasis features a conversation with Hanif Khalil, the visionary founder of Aflaha Sports Management Group and Crescent Sports Media. Join host Haqq Islam as they explore how Islam is shaping the future of sports, from the rise of Muslim athletes like Jaylen Brown and Kyrie Irving to the intersection of faith, discipline, and athleticism.
Hanif shares his journey from aspiring sports agent to a leader in the global halal economy, highlighting the values of community, cultural identity, and personal growth that drive his work.
Discover how his organization empowers athletes and brands through talent management, branding, and consulting, while amplifying the voices of Muslims in sports. Whether you're intrigued by the evolving role of Muslim athletes in collegiate and professional sports, the cultural impact of the halal economy, or the inspiring stories of pioneers like Muhammad Ali, Mahmoud Abdul-Rauf, Malcom X this episode is for you.
